Georgetown University in Qatar will continue to require submission of either the TOEFL, IELTS, or Duolingo for all applicants. We waive the English language proficiency exam requirement for applicants who score 620 or higher on the Evidence-Based Reading and Writing section of the SAT or 26 or higher on the ACT Reading/Writing sections.8. Plan on participating in two rounds of interviews: a first-round, which may take place on campus or at the firm’s office, and a second round called a “Superday.” A Superday is a series of 30-minute interviews back-to-back, usually at the firm’s office. Firms are not only testing you on what you know, but also on your endurance.AAP Portal. The Alumni Admissions Program (AAP) is a worldwide alumni volunteer organization that coordinates and conducts the interview process for first-year and transfer applicants to Georgetown University. Over 6,000 alumni strong, the AAP interviews the vast majority of applicants. Members of the AAP may be involved in ...Georgetown does not have on-campus interviews, and if there are no alumni near you, this requirement is waived and it won't hurt your application. You'll receive information via mail or email explaining how to set up the interview, typically two to four weeks after you complete Step 1.
